Guangzhou, often referred to as the "City of Rams," is a major port city and the capital of Guangdong Province in southern China. Renowned for its Cantonese cuisine, ancient temples, and modern skyscrapers, Guangzhou offers a blend of traditional and contemporary experiences. To learn more about this dynamic city, consider reading "Factory Girls: From Village to City in a Changing China" by Leslie T. Chang. This book delves into the lives of young migrant women working in factories in Guangzhou, providing a compelling look at China's rapid urbanization and social changes. For those who prefer documentaries, "The Chinese Mayor" offers a fascinating insight into the challenges faced by mayors in China's rapidly growing cities. This documentary follows the charismatic mayor of Datong as he navigates efforts to transform the city while preserving its historical heritage, offering a thought-provoking look at urban development in China. On the other hand, Mumbai, the bustling metropolis on the west coast of India, is known for its Bollywood film industry, bustling markets, and vibrant street food culture. To immerse yourself in the spirit of Mumbai, consider reading "Maximum City: Bombay Lost and Found" by Suketu Mehta. This engrossing book offers a deep dive into the heart of Mumbai, exploring its contradictions, dreams, and realities through the lens of its diverse inhabitants. If you're looking for a visual journey through Mumbai, the documentary "Bombay: Our City" captures the everyday struggles and aspirations of the city's residents. Through intimate interviews and stunning cinematography, this documentary sheds light on the challenges faced by those living in the city's slums and high-rise towers, portraying Mumbai's complex tapestry of life.
